Output ee36c60bcb528ed3beb158201e21c17d25f996feb45f1e19ef7aa362fb81722a:19

value
83814
script pubkey
OP_0 OP_PUSHBYTES_20 d3be0be1fde1f781098629408489e2a4d04a008b
address
bc1q6wlqhc0au8mczzvx99qgfz0z5ngy5qytl9a7aj
transaction
ee36c60bcb528ed3beb158201e21c17d25f996feb45f1e19ef7aa362fb81722a
spent
true